Synthesis and Spectral Investigation (H-1 and C-13) of Tetradentate Schiff Base Ligands for the Preparation of Post Transition Bimetallic Complexes of Antimicrobial Importance

摘要
A tetradentate Schiff base ligand 2-(bis-2-hydroxylphenylidene)-1,2-diiminoethanne (L) was synthesized and then its structure was investigated by H-1 NMR and C-13 NMR techniques. The ligand and its bimetallic complexes were screened in vitro for antibacterial and antifungal activities by using disc diffusion method. The results showed that in case of antibacterial activity the Co2L2 exhibited better efficiency (9 +/- 0.816) against E. coli while binuclear complex of Mn2L2 showed better potential against all the three strains (E. coli, S. aureus and A. alternate) as compared with other attempted bimetallic (Cu, Mn and Zn) complexes when compared with standard one. Similarly the antifungal potential of binuclear (Co2L2) complex was satisfactory (12.25 +/- 0.062) for A. alternate while the binuclear Cu2L2 complex exhibited good effect (7.75 +/- 0.957) against A. niger. Similarly binuclear Mn2L2 complex showed better efficiency (10.25 +/- 0.5) against A. flavous. The biological activity data justified that binuclear post transition metal complexes with Schiff base can be successfully used against fungal as well as bacterial infections.
